Key Features to Look For
When I’m on the hunt for the ideal outdoor thermometer, I ensure it possesses key features that meet my specific needs:
Temperature Range and Accuracy
I make sure to check that the thermometer offers a temperature range suitable for my local climate. Most reliable models work within a range of -40°F to 120°F, which is ideal for tracking seasonal changes without fail. Accuracy is key; the best outdoor thermometers claim an accuracy of ±1°F, meaning I can trust their readings.
Weather Resistance and Durability
A good outdoor thermometer should endure various weather conditions. I look for products with weather-proof ratings; some thermometers boast IP67 ratings, indicating extreme durability against water and dust, essential for prolonged use outdoors.
Readability and Design
As I often check the temperature from several feet away, readability is vital. I prefer models with bold, large font displays that are clear and user-friendly. Many USA-made thermometers also come with backlighting for evening visibility, enhancing the overall experience.

Installation and Maintenance Tips
To keep my outdoor thermometer in top shape, I follow a few straightforward installation and maintenance tips:
How to Properly Install Your Outdoor Thermometer
Correct placement is crucial. I avoid spots that receive direct sunlight, such as walls or fences. Instead, I find a shaded area at least 5 feet above the ground, ensuring accurate readings.
Routine Maintenance for Longevity
I routinely check my thermometer for wear and tear. Cleaning the surface regularly helps maintain accuracy—using a soft cloth to gently wipe away dirt ensures the reading is free from interference.
